HEARING OFFICER ORDER
On Wednesday, April 23, 2008, prior to the start of hearing in Des Plaines, a prehearing
conference was held pursuant to 35 Ill. Adm. Code 102.404. The participants discussed hearing
dates and how best to organize the remaining hearings. The participants agreed to begin with the
use designations for the Chicago Area Waterways System (CAWS) to be followed by the use
designations for the lower Des Plaines River. This organization will include testimony on
recreational use designations for the two areas. Prefiling deadlines were also discussed and those
were tentatively set for August 4, 2008, for prefiled testimony and August 25, 2008, for prefiled
questions.
Today hearings are set in September. The hearings will be continued day-to-day until
business is concluded. If there are questions and testimony remaining at the close of business on

 
2
September 10, 2008, hearings may be resumed on September 23, 2008, and continue on
September 24 and 25, 2008.
When the testimony and questioning on use designations are completed, additional
hearing dates to hear testimony on the water quality standards will be scheduled. Participants
should be prepared to discuss additional hearing dates at that time.
Testimony must be prefiled by August 4, 2008 and the mailbox rule does not apply.
Prefiled questions must be filed by August 25, 2008 and the mailbox rule does not apply. If
these deadlines cannot be met, a motion must be filed with the hearing officer explaining why
and how long an extension is being sought. Any motion to extend these prefiling deadlines must
be filed prior to these deadlines and any response is to be filed within seven (7) days of receipt,
to avoid undue delay in this proceeding.
